What Amazon Allows — and What It Doesn't
Amazon's Communication Guidelines prohibit incentivized reviews, "review gating" (selectively soliciting only happy buyers), and requesting a specific star rating. The only compliant methods for requesting reviews are:
- Amazon's "Request a Review" button — a non-editable, Amazon-standardized message sent 5–30 days after delivery. 100% ToS-compliant.
- Custom buyer-seller messaging emails — permitted under Seller Central's Buyer-Seller Messaging System, but must not ask for a specific star rating, contain marketing content, or include external links (other than product instructions or warranty info).
Every tool on this page is Amazon ToS-compliant as of April 2026. Review solicitation rules can change — always verify with Amazon's current Communication Guidelines before deploying campaigns.

eComEngine FeedbackFive
Dashboard Screenshot — Coming Soon
eComEngine's FeedbackFive has been the trusted choice for Amazon sellers since 2007 — nearly two decades of staying ahead of Amazon's ever-changing communication rules.
FeedbackFive specializes in automating Amazon's native "Request a Review" message — the non-editable, Amazon-standardized request that is definitively 100% ToS-compliant. For sellers who are risk-averse or have been burned by policy changes in the past, FeedbackFive's compliance-first philosophy offers genuine peace of mind. In our testing, setup was the fastest of any tool on this list: connecting a seller account and enabling automations took under 10 minutes.
Pricing is order-volume-based, starting from approximately $24/mo for lower-volume sellers, with plans scaling by monthly order count. All plans include the full feature set — there are no features locked behind higher tiers. The tool supports 17 Amazon marketplaces, making it a strong choice for international sellers. A free trial is available; check eComEngine's pricing page for current tier details, as order-based pricing can vary.

Jungle Scout Review Automation
8.4/10Jungle Scout Review Automation — Screenshot Coming Soon
Jungle Scout's Review Automation feature automatically triggers Amazon's official "Request a Review" message for every eligible order — timed to maximize response rates while staying definitively within Amazon's ToS.
The feature is genuinely set-and-forget: once enabled at the product or account level, Jungle Scout handles scheduling, eligibility checking (Amazon's 5–30 day window), and execution automatically. In our testing, it was the simplest implementation of review automation across all six tools — a meaningful advantage for sellers who don't want to think about campaign management. It is included in the Growth Accelerator plan ($79/mo as of April 2026) and above. Sellers on the Starter plan ($49/mo) should verify whether the feature is included on their tier, as plan features can change.

Frequently Asked Questions
Is it against Amazon's ToS to use review automation tools? expand_more
No — using automation tools to send Amazon's official "Request a Review" message is permitted and compliant. What Amazon prohibits is incentivizing reviews, asking for a specific star rating, or "review gating" (selectively requesting reviews only from buyers you believe had a positive experience). All six tools on this page are designed to operate within Amazon's current Communication Guidelines, as of April 2026. Always verify against Amazon's most current policy, as rules can change.
What is the difference between "Request a Review" automation and custom email automation? expand_more
"Request a Review" automation triggers Amazon's own standardized, non-editable review request message on your behalf — this method is definitively ToS-compliant. Custom email automation uses the Buyer-Seller Messaging System to send personalized emails you write, which are also permitted but must comply with Amazon's content rules (no star rating requests, no marketing content, no external links except product instructions). Tools like FeedbackWhiz and FeedbackFive support both methods; Jungle Scout and Sellerise focus on the "Request a Review" approach.

How soon after a purchase can I send a review request? expand_more
Amazon's current eligibility window is 5 to 30 days after delivery confirmation. Sending a review request before 5 days or after 30 days is outside Amazon's permitted window. Best practice based on our testing and industry observation is to target the 7–10 day post-delivery period — after buyers have had time to use the product but while the experience is still fresh. All tools on this list manage this timing automatically.
